Yes, but the STP rules for apartments in Bangalore vary depending on the apartment's size and whether an underground drainage (UGD) line is present.
The STP mandate has been updated by the Karnataka government. STPs in 2016 were mandatory for all constructions with more than 50 units; they were even made essential for projects with more than 20 units, which sparked strong protests throughout Bengaluru.
The most recent regulations state that if the region has a UGD line, apartment buildings with more than 120 units and producing more than 80 KLD of sewage must install an in-situ STP. This brings relief to many core-city apartments.
Regardless of sewage output, a STP is still required for any complexes larger than 20 units if your project is located in an area without UGD lines.
Smaller STPs are expensive and ineffective.
After lobbying by the Bangalore Apartments Federation (BAF), the government revised the norms to make compliance practical.
